Fort Washington on the Ohio River, 1789

Fort Washington on the site that became Cincinnati, Ohio, 1789.
Hand-colored woodcut of a 19th-century illustration

This hand-colored woodcut print takes us back to the year 1789, offering a glimpse into the rich history of Fort Washington on the Ohio River. The image showcases the site that would eventually become Cincinnati, Ohio, in all its pioneer glory. In this vintage illustration, we witness a traditional American military outpost nestled within a frontier landscape. The fort stands tall and proud with its stockade walls protecting settlers from potential threats. Soldiers dressed in 18th-century uniforms patrol diligently, ensuring the safety of those who have ventured into this new settlement. The artwork beautifully captures the essence of life during this time period in North America's history. It serves as a reminder of the brave men and women who paved the way for future generations by establishing settlements like Cincinnati. As we delve deeper into this visual masterpiece, it becomes evident that Fort Washington played a crucial role in shaping not only local but also national history. Situated within what was then known as Northwest Territory, it symbolizes both American expansionism and military might.
